Tech Imaginations Zambia

Benefits of Our custom software development services

With technical excellence and extensive engineering experience, Tech Imaginations cultivates a culture of engagement to deliver a solution tailored to your specific goals and objectives.

End-to-end software solutions

created via a full spectrum of IT services, extensive technical expertise, and well-adjusted solution design.

Quality software products

as a result of effective service delivery, certified proficiency, cutting-edge technology, and an efficient SDLC

Cost efficiency

achieved with optimized resource provisioning and a lean technical design that is tailored to each scenario

Constraint management

with a unique framework for accelerated development that brings extra value and minimizes project risks

Operational flexibility and visibility

ensured via well-organized change management, proactive problem solving, and transparent communication

More custom development solutions

Saas development
Enterprise software development
Mobile app development

Frequently Asked Questions

We combine our domain expertise, technical excellence, skilled in-house development teams, and well-established processes with your vision to create a great software product for your business. To do this, we follow these fundamental tenets:

  • Client-centric development and open communication processes
  • Compliance with the latest data security requirements in your industry
  • Intellectual property rights protection for your software product
  • Smooth and continuous delivery and support processes
  • Established processes for collaborating off-site and on-site
  • Maximum project predictability and detailed documentation

The availability of CoEs indicates that a software engineering vendor has achieved a high level of maturity and can guarantee top-quality services. A CoE is an expert team dedicated to a specific technology, industry, or skill within an organization. Our CoEs have implemented frameworks and approaches for successful project delivery based on our experience with hundreds of client projects. In addition, our CoEs facilitate the constant development of our overall technical proficiency, since they share innovative practices with the rest of the company.

Here’s what helps us build software solutions tailored to your unique business objectives and processes:

Industry-dedicated delivery units. We’ve built diverse teams of professionals in software engineering, architecture, business analysis, project management, and other spheres that have experience in particular industries. This allows us to create relevant technical solutions taking into account industry standards, laws, and regulations as well as to maximize the value delivered to our clients. Currently, we have delivery units for supply chain management, healthcare, IoT, FinTech, and real estate. 

Agile software development. Our clients benefit from full control over their projects, process transparency and visibility, early and predictable delivery, adherence to cost estimates and schedules, and the ability to make changes and corrections as needed. As you determine the priority of your functionality, we get to understand what’s most important for your business and customers so we can focus on delivering features that provide the most business value. 

Our cybersecurity experts work to ensure that your IT systems and data are safe from intrusion and comply with GDPR, HIPAA, and other requirements. We not only assess your current security system but also provide real-time information on security vulnerabilities and create and re-engineer a secure architecture that ensures the protection of individuals’ privacy.

The steps below help us develop, launch, and augment your innovative product: 

  • Define business goals and objectives for a detailed and accurate project roadmap
  • Elaborate on the product vision and non-functional requirements in tight collaboration with your team 
  • Design a cost-effective custom technical solution in accordance with the product vision and strategy
  • Develop the software application and user experience based on software design documentation
  • Use quality control and management systems to deliver a high-quality product
  • Ensure a stable product launch and successful operation to secure your business from potential losses
  • Evolve product functionality based on insights from data analytics and user feedback

CALL US 24/7

Need Our Expertise?
Get InTouch Today!

Contact Detail

error: Content is protected !!